Senior Data Center Performance Engineer - Benchmarking and Optimization

2 Locations

Found: December 10, 2025

This role is based in Santa Clara, CA or available for remote work.

Compensation:

$184,000 - $356,500/year based on level and experience.

Responsibilities:

  • Design and execute performance benchmarking strategies for data center platforms.
  • Characterize AI training, inference, and HPC workloads.
  • Define and report key performance indicators.
  • Build automation tools for performance monitoring.
  • Analyze performance bottlenecks across various subsystems.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to resolve performance issues.

Requirements:

  • M.S. or Ph.D. in Computer Science, Electrical Engineering, or related field.
  • 8+ years of experience in performance engineering or system architecture.
  • Strong proficiency in performance profiling tools and GPU computing.
  • Programming skills in Python, C++, and shell scripting.

Tech stack:

Linux, CUDA, InfiniBand, NVLink, Python, C++.
